The Comprehensive Eye Assessment
When you're considering LASIK, the comprehensive eye assessment is your initial step toward clearer vision. This thorough evaluation entails different tests to determine your eye health and wellness and certain vision requirements.
Your eye doctor will measure your corneal density, refraction, and total eye shape, guaranteeing you're a suitable candidate for the treatment. They'll also look for any kind of eye conditions that might influence your LASIK end result.
Anticipate to respond to inquiries regarding your vision history and any type of existing issues. By the end of this examination, you'll have a clear understanding of your eye health and wellness and whether LASIK is the right selection for you.
This process establishes the foundation for a successful procedure and optimum cause your trip to better vision.
Reviewing Your Case History and Way Of Living
Just how well do you recognize your case history and lifestyle habits? During your LASIK examination, this knowledge is vital. Your doctor will certainly ask about any kind of previous eye problems, surgical procedures, or ongoing wellness concerns.
Be sincere concerning medications, allergies, and family history of eye illness. This info aids the specialist evaluate your suitability for the treatment.
They'll additionally want to discuss your day-to-day routines, consisting of work routines, screen time, and sporting activities participation. These aspects can influence your recovery and lasting results.
If you use contact lenses, share exactly how typically and why you choose them over glasses. Recognizing your way of life enables your surgeon to customize recommendations, guaranteeing the most effective feasible outcome for your vision modification journey.
